Declining RevenuesA durable downward revenue trend erodes scale, weakens pricing power and reduces funds available for R&D or capital expenditures. Continued top-line contraction pressures margins and the aftermarket base, making multi-month recovery harder in a capital goods industry.
Negative ProfitabilitySustained negative operating and net results indicate structural profitability issues. Persistent losses undermine retained earnings, constrain reinvestment, and reduce resilience to demand shocks. Negative returns make funding growth and preserving dividends more difficult over time.
Weak Free Cash Flow ConversionDifficulty converting earnings into free cash flow limits capacity to fund capex, service debt and support operations without external financing. In capital-intensive machinery, weak FCF conversion is a structural vulnerability that can restrict strategic flexibility over months.
